It has come to our attention that an email is in circulation advising that you have received a tax refund from HMRC, the email then requires you to click on a link to go through the government gateway. HMRC will NEVER email you advising of a refund.

As part of a £900m investment, HM Revenue and Customs are deploying extra task forces to curb the activities of tax dodgers. These teams are expected to recover more than £30m for the public purse.
